Understanding Excel: A Brief Overview
Before we explore synonyms, let's ensure we're on the same page regarding Excel. At its core, Excel is a spreadsheet program that stores data in a grid of cells, organized into rows and columns. It's part of the Microsoft Office suite and is widely used for data analysis, visualization, and reporting. Excel's versatility lies in its ability to perform calculations, create charts and graphs, and automate tasks using macros.

Software Alternatives
- LibreOffice Calc: An open-source alternative to Excel, offering similar functionality at no cost.
- Google Sheets: A cloud-based spreadsheet program that allows real-time collaboration and easy sharing.
- Apple Numbers: A spreadsheet program included in the iWork suite, designed for Mac users.
File Formats
- .xls: The original Excel file format, now less common than the .xlsx format.
- .xlsx: The default file format for Excel 2007 and later versions. It's based on the Open XML standard.
- .csv: A simple, comma-separated values format often used for data exchange between different software applications.
